Abstract

The utility model discloses a straight stroke electric actuator scale indicator which comprises an installation block, a sliding ruler which is arranged on one side of the installation block in a sliding mode in the length direction of the installation block, the top of the sliding ruler is connected with an indicating head, and the bottom of the sliding ruler penetrates through the bottom wall of the installation block to be connected with a linkage plate. Scale marks are arranged on the installation block along the motion trail of the indicating head. Compared with the prior art, the straight stroke electric actuator scale indicator has the advantages that the straight stroke electric actuator scale indicator can be conveniently matched with an existing small straight stroke actuator for use and can be conveniently matched with the existing small straight stroke actuator for stroke indication.

Technical Field

[0001] The utility model relates to the technical field of scale indicators of linear actuators, in particular to a scale indicator of a linear electric actuator. Background Art

[0002] When processing parts, linear actuators are often used. Linear actuators can be used both electrically and manually. However, in order to meet different usage needs, the required motion strokes of small linear actuators in the prior art are not consistent. However, most of the existing small linear actuators lack stroke indicators, which makes it impossible for users to intuitively judge the stroke distance during use, which may affect their actual use effect. Utility Model Content

[0003] (1) Problems to be solved

[0004] The technical problem to be solved by the present invention is to overcome the above technical defects and provide a linear electric actuator scale indicator which is convenient for use with an existing small linear actuator and convenient for performing stroke indication in conjunction with the existing small linear actuator.

[0005] (2) Technical solution

[0006] In order to solve the above technical problems, the technical solution provided by the utility model is as follows: a linear electric actuator scale indicator includes a mounting block, a sliding ruler is provided on one side of the mounting block and is slidably arranged along its length direction, the top of the sliding ruler is connected to an indicating head, the bottom of the sliding ruler passes through the bottom wall of the mounting block and is connected to a linkage plate, and scale marks are provided on the mounting block along the motion trajectory of the indicating head.

[0007] As an improvement, the mounting block includes an upper shell and a lower shell, and a plurality of threaded grooves corresponding to the positions of the upper shell and the lower shell are provided between the upper shell and the lower shell. Positioning bolts are connected in the threaded grooves to form a sliding channel between the upper shell and the lower shell.

[0008] As an improvement, an L-shaped connecting arm is connected between the indicating head and the sliding ruler, and a stopper is provided on the top of the sliding ruler away from the L-shaped connecting arm;

[0009] The middle part of the upper shell is provided with a notch arranged along its length direction, and the scale mark is arranged along the length direction of the notch. A guide groove is formed between the stopper and the L-shaped connecting arm and is engaged with the groove wall of the notch.

[0010] As an improvement, a positioning linkage hole is provided on the linkage plate through its side wall.

[0011] (3) Beneficial effects

[0012] The advantages of the present invention compared with the prior art are: in this application, it is convenient to install with the existing actuator through the mounting block, is connected to the sliding end of the actuator through the linkage plate, and indicates the scale after movement through the indicator head, thereby meeting the use needs and being convenient to adapt to the use of most actuators. [0022] Please refer to the attached Figure 1-3 The linear electric actuator scale indicator includes a mounting block 1, one side of the mounting block 1 is provided with a sliding ruler 2 slidingly arranged along its length direction, the top of the sliding ruler 2 is connected with an indicating head 3, the bottom of the sliding ruler 2 passes through the bottom wall of the mounting block 1 and is connected to a linkage plate 4, and a scale mark 5 is provided on the mounting block 1 along the motion trajectory of the indicating head 3.

[0023] In specific use, the mounting block 1 includes an upper shell 6 and a lower shell 7. A plurality of corresponding threaded grooves 8 are provided between the upper shell 6 and the lower shell 7. Positioning bolts are connected in the threaded grooves 8. A sliding channel 9 is formed between the upper shell 6 and the lower shell 7. An L-shaped connecting arm 10 is connected between the indicating head 3 and the sliding ruler 2. A stopper 11 is also provided on the top of the sliding ruler 2 away from the L-shaped connecting arm 10.

[0024] In order to facilitate the use of guidance, the middle part of the upper shell 6 is provided with a notch 12 arranged along its length direction, and the scale mark 5 is arranged along the length direction of the notch 12. A guide groove is formed between the stop block 11 and the L-shaped connecting arm 10, and the groove wall of the notch 12 is locked. A positioning linkage hole 13 is provided on the linkage plate 4 through its side wall. The positioning linkage hole 13 can be connected to the sliding end of the actuator to complete the linkage, so that the indicating head 3 slides to indicate the scale.

[0025] In actual application, the installation and fixation of the mounting block is completed by clamping the sliding groove and the straight-stroke actuator column. The corresponding size specifications can be adjusted for use according to different actuator specifications. After fixation, the positioning linkage hole 13 and the sliding end of the actuator are linked by means of additional positioning blocks, positioning bolts, etc. At this time, the movement of the indicator head 3 can be controlled when the actuator is used to complete the scale indication.
